UTM Parameters

Summary

This page explains how to configure UTM parameters for Pop traffic and use them to track traffic sources in your analytics systems.

Before You Begin
What Are UTM Parameters?

UTM parameters are tags added to a URL to help identify and analyze the source and context of incoming traffic.

DAO.AD allows you to add custom UTM parameters when creating an advertising code for the Popunder format.

These parameters are automatically added to the destination URL when a user is redirected after opening a Pop ad.

Available Parameters

DAO.AD supports the following UTM parameters:

Parameter

Description

Example

utm_source

Identifies the traffic source

dao

utm_medium

Identifies the traffic type or format

pop

utm_campaign

Identifies the campaign or project

casino

utm_term

Additional tracking parameter

news

utm_content

Identifies the site, ad placement, or another custom value

site123

How to Configure UTM Parameters

When creating a Popunder advertising code:

  1. Open the UTM parameters section.
  2. Enter the required values for the parameters you want to use.
  3. Save the advertising code.
  4. Place the generated code on your website.

DAO.AD will automatically add the configured parameters to the destination URL.

Example

For example, you can configure:

utm_source = dao, utm_medium = pop, utm_campaign = casino, utm_term = news, utm_content = site123

The resulting URL may look like:

https://example.com/?utm_source=dao&utm_medium=pop&utm_campaign=casino&utm_term=news&utm_content=site123

This allows you to identify the source and additional details of the traffic in your analytics or tracking system.

Automated Campaign Optimization

Advertisers may use automated optimization tools to adjust traffic demand (CPA Goal, in Popunder) and bids based on campaign performance and conversion data.

As a result, the availability and price of traffic may change over time for a particular source, GEO, device, or advertising format.

Traffic volume and revenue may therefore increase or decrease depending on current advertiser demand and campaign performance.

Important: A temporary decrease in traffic volume, CPM, or revenue does not necessarily indicate a problem with your traffic source or integration.
